The Thriller Spectrum

The archive's thrillers range across several intensities:

  • Cozy Mystery: Lighter mysteries with puzzle-solving and charm
  • Psychological Thriller: Mind games, unreliable narrators, gaslit realities
  • Erotic Thriller: Where desire and danger intersect
  • Culinary Thriller: Food, culture, and murder
  • Horror: Where the thriller becomes something darker

Reading Recommendations

If you want a page-turner: Start with the book that has the shortest chapters — fast chapter breaks create a "one more chapter" effect. If you want psychological depth: Choose the books with themes like "psychological manipulation" or "trauma." If you want Indian settings: Most of these thrillers are set in Indian cities — Pune, Mumbai, Delhi — adding a layer of cultural specificity rare in the genre. — Reading Guide from the Inamdar Archive
